
The Wilson Sensation Control 16G is a specialized version of the classic Sensation multifilament, engineered to bridge the gap between the ultra-soft feel of a traditional comfort string and the crisp, predictable response of a control string. By incorporating LCP (Liquid Crystal Polymer) fibers into its construction, Wilson has created a more disciplined version of Sensation that reduces the "mushy" feel sometimes found in soft multifilaments.
Performance Profile
- LCP Fiber Integration: Unlike the standard Sensation, which focuses purely on softness, the Control version features Liquid Crystal Polymer fibers. These provide a firmer feel and a quicker snap-back, which helps keep the ball's trajectory more consistent.
- Precision and Predictability: While it remains a multifilament, it offers a "crisper" impact. This allows players to feel the ball better on the strings, providing the confidence needed to aim for smaller targets and corners.
- Vibration Dampening: It maintains the core DNA of the Sensation family, which was one of the first strings to use high-grade nylon fibers to mimic natural gut. It effectively absorbs high-frequency vibrations to protect the arm.
- Balanced Power: It provides a moderate amount of "free power." It is less bouncy than Sensation Comfort, making it easier for hard hitters to maintain depth control without the ball "flying" long.

Pro Tip:
If you are coming from the standard Sensation and find the Control version feels a bit too firm, try dropping your tension by 2–3 lbs. Conversely, if you want to maximize the "control" aspect of the LCP fibers, stringing it at the higher end of your racquet's recommended range will provide a very precise, professional-feeling string bed.
